In ano<strong>the</strong>r narration, Hadhrat Abu Khunays Ghifaari %.Wj reports that <strong>the</strong>y<br />

were with Rasulullaah @%% on an expedition to Tihaamah and it was at a place<br />

called Usfaan that <strong>the</strong> <strong>Sahabah</strong> @G3w approached Rasulullaah w... <strong>The</strong><br />

narration continues like <strong>the</strong> one above without <strong>the</strong> part stating that Rasulullaah<br />

smiled. <strong>The</strong>reafter, it states that after Rasulullaah @@ gave <strong>the</strong> command<br />

to leave, it started raining and Rasulullaah toge<strong>the</strong>r with <strong>the</strong> <strong>Sahabah</strong><br />

i43GWi-j dismounted and drank from <strong>the</strong> water <strong>of</strong> <strong>the</strong> skies. (')<br />

Hadhrat Abu Hurayrah %3Gw and Hadhrat Abu Sa'eed Khudri St5Wj both<br />

report that when <strong>the</strong> <strong>Sahabah</strong> i@GWj suffered extreme hunger during <strong>the</strong><br />

expedition to Tabook, <strong>the</strong>y approached Rasulullaah saying, "0 Rasulullaah<br />

'&%! Do permit us to slaughter <strong>the</strong> camels we use for drawing water so that we<br />

can have some food and oil." "You may do so," Rasulullaah $@ permitted. It was<br />

<strong>the</strong>n that Hadhrat Umar 3,- intervened.. ." <strong>The</strong> rest <strong>of</strong> <strong>the</strong> narration is like <strong>the</strong><br />

one above narrated by Hadhrat Abu Arnrah 5%~j.(~)<br />

Hadhrat Salamah 3.GMj reports, "We were with Rasulullaah @@! in <strong>the</strong> Battle <strong>of</strong><br />

Khaybar when he instructed us to ga<strong>the</strong>r all our provisions <strong>of</strong> dates toge<strong>the</strong>r.<br />

Rasulullaah @% <strong>the</strong>n spread out a lea<strong>the</strong>r tablecloth, on which we spread <strong>the</strong><br />

provisions.out. I <strong>the</strong>n calculated and studied <strong>the</strong> pile, finally estimating it to be<br />

<strong>the</strong> size <strong>of</strong> a sitting goat. We numbered fourteen hundred on that day and after<br />

we had all eaten, I again calculated and studied <strong>the</strong> pile and again estimated it to<br />

be <strong>the</strong> size <strong>of</strong> a sitting goat." <strong>The</strong> narration <strong>the</strong>n continues to mention an incident<br />

<strong>of</strong> blessing in <strong>the</strong>ir water. (4) In ano<strong>the</strong>r narration, Hadhrat Salamah 5Ww says,<br />

"We <strong>the</strong>n ate to our fill and also filled our satchels. (5)<br />
